Despite a run of less-than-stellar pitching, the Red Sox didn’t add anyone at Friday’s deadline to acquire postseason-eligible players, instead hoping that September callups and hurlers returning from injury would be enough to right the ship. Eduardo Rodriguez proved that strategy prudent in his return from the disabled list on Saturday, striking out 12 over 5 2/3 strong innings. His White Sox counterpart, Carlos Rodon, was sharp until he was chased in Boston’s three-run seventh. Eduardo Nunez, Jackie Bradley Jr. and Ian Kinsler homered for the Red Sox.

Not since Matt Kemp went swimming in the Chase Field pool has he caused such aggravation for the D-backs as he did at Dodger Stadium on Saturday night, when he launched a three-run homer off Archie Bradley in the eighth inning to give the Dodgers a second consecutive stunning comeback win and a share of the NL West lead.

Tyler White broke open a tie game in the bottom of the eighth inning with a two-out, two-run double, sparking the Astros to a 7-3 come-from-behind victory over the Angels at Minute Maid Park. Making his first Major League start, right-hander Josh James — ranked as Houston’s No. 6 prospect by MLB Pipeline — allowed three runs on three hits and three walks while striking out nine, tied for second by an Astros starter making his debut.

Red Sox manager Alex Cora wasn’t exactly certain what he would get out of Eduardo Rodriguez on Saturday night. It didn’t take long for Rodriguez to give Cora his answer. In his first Major League start since July 14, Rodriguez struck out a season-high 12 hitters and began his outing with four perfect innings against the White Sox en route to a 6-1 victory at Guaranteed Rate Field .

For the first time since late July, the Cubs’ lineup looked more complete with the return of Kris Bryant. Back after missing more than a month because of a sore left shoulder, Bryant doubled in the third inning to help set up Kyle Schwarber’s two-run triple, and Ian Happ added a solo home run in the Cubs’ victory on Saturday night over the Phillies at Citizens Bank Park.
